Output 61dd9545bbae6bfbb3fcefc3c44e00cf3482148d618b43df693e1d0d2f5b24b9:0

value
86000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c52ee95f99caecda77cb4b0536b0a886a48f13f6 OP_EQUAL
address
3KfdEoxmneE6MzeXkLky8FX9nwx1TuAub8
transaction
61dd9545bbae6bfbb3fcefc3c44e00cf3482148d618b43df693e1d0d2f5b24b9
confirmations
121679
spent
true